What is an operational amplifier (Op Amps)?

An operational amplifier is a DC-coupled high potential electronic current amplifier embedded with a differential input and, commonly, one terminal output. In this installation, an operational amplifier generates an output capability that is typically 100,000 times greater than the potential difference between its input points. The first analog computers employed operational amplifiers to carry out mathematical operations in linear, non-linear, and frequency-dependent circuits.

How do Op Amps work?

Mathematical operations, including addition, multiplication, differentiation, and integration, are offered by Amps. They are voltage amplifiers with a single-ended output and a differential input in most cases.

An operational amplifier has two inputs, known as inverting (-) and non-inverting (+) inputs. The output voltage would drop if the inverting input voltage were raised. Alternately, increasing the voltage at the non-inverting input causes an increase in output voltage. The output won't change if both inputs get an equal voltage.

Op Amp Applications

Op amps are employed in a huge range of electronic applications. A voltage follower, a selective inversion circuit, a current-to-voltage converter, an active rectifier, an integrator, a vast array of filters, and a voltage comparator are a few of the more popular uses. Low Noise CMOS Op Amps, Linear Technology Advanced CMOS operational amplifiers from Linear Technology offering ultra-low input bias currents and low noise combined with low power consumption and stable operating characteristics. Outputs are typically capable of swinging within 50mV of the supply rails maximizing dynamic range in low supply voltage applications. Input common mode range includes ground, and often includes both supply rails. Zero-Drift Op Amps, Linear Technology A range of high performance zero-drift operational amplifiers from Linear Technology suitable for applications where high precision and negligible DC offset are required. These highly integrated devices are generally chopper stabilized and incorporate internal sample-and-hold capacitors. Typical applications include thermocouple amplifiers, electronic weigh scales, medical instrumentation, strain-gauge amplifiers, DC-accurate active filters, 4 to 20mA current loops and high resolution data acquisition. JFET Input Op Amps, Linear Technology A range of high-performance JFET input operational amplifiers from Linear Technology. With input bias currents as low as 10pA or less these op amps are ideal for applications requiring minimal circuit loading such as integrators and photodiode amplifiers. Many of these devices are available in single, dual and quad package configurations and may be used to upgrade the performance of circuits using earlier generations of JFET Op amps.
